Is anyone familiar with adjustments on a Turner band resaw? This old vertical saw has an acme threaded rod to lift the idler wheel (on a dovetail slide)

 

 

 and tension the sawblade and it has a hand wheel to adjust the blade tracking. It also has a spring that is compressed (with pointer) to indicate blade tension. It also has an adjustable threaded pin that sits in the pivot point of the arm that connects the axle and spring. I am repurposing the drive and idler wheels to build a horizontal bandmill with a double acting hydraulic cylinder and hand pump to replace the acme threaded rod that was used on the original setup. The double acting cylinder will tension the blade and pull the head back to remove the blade. I am not sure I will even need the spring/indicator pointer now as I can tension the blade and get feedback on tension from my hydraulic gauge. Thoughts? Also, any ideas of what the adjustable pin at the pivot point is all about? Here are a couple pics that might help.
